    About this experience

    This combo is only available to book online — you won't find this 3-attraction bundle at the door. Make the most of your time at San Francisco's iconic PIER 39 with this exclusive 3-attraction pass. Soar above the city on The Flyer — Northern California's only flying theater — as you glide over the Golden Gate Bridge, Alcatraz, and Muir Woods with motion, wind, and scent effects that bring every landmark to life. Then grab a blaster and battle your way through the 7D Ride Experience, an immersive motion ride where up to 20 players compete in real time against zombies, robot cowboys, or werewolves — check the scoreboard when you're done. Round it all out with the Laser Maze Challenge, a fast-paced test of agility and stealth where every move counts. Three thrills. One pass. Book online and save — adults save $8 and children save $5 compared to purchasing each attraction individually at the door.

    Know before you go

    • Wheelchair accessible
    • Public transportation options are available nearby
    • All areas and surfaces are wheelchair accessible
    • Not recommended for pregnant travelers
    • Not recommended for travelers with poor cardiovascular health
    • Suitable for all physical fitness levels
    • Riders must be under 300 lbs (136 kg)
    • No lap riding for infants or small children
    • Riders must be at least 40 inches (102 cm) tall

    When is the best time to visit San Francisco?

    +

    September and October, the city's real summer, once the fog season breaks. Booking patterns follow the same curve: prices and queues climb in peak weeks, while shoulder season gives you better availability on the top-ranked experiences and more room to change plans.

    How many days do you need in San Francisco?

    +

    Three full days covers the headline sights without sprinting. A workable rhythm is one anchor experience each morning, such as this one, an unhurried afternoon in a single neighborhood, then a food or nightlife booking in the evening. Five days lets you add a day trip outside the city.
